What affects the price

Medicare costs aren't one-size-fits-all. Your monthly premium depends on a few moving parts, such as the specific plan type you choose, your zip code, and your current health needs. Whether you need extra coverage for prescriptions or prefer a plan that includes dental and vision benefits, these choices shift the total amount you pay. Some people find plans with low monthly premiums, while others prioritize lower out-of-pocket costs when they visit a doctor. Is Medicare free after 65?

Part A of Medicare, which covers hospital stays, is often free if you or your spouse paid Medicare taxes for a certain period. However, Part B, covering doctor visits and outpatient services, typically has a monthly premium. The pros can help you determine your eligibility for premium-free Part A in Greensboro.

What are the 6 things Medicare doesn't cover?

Medicare generally excludes coverage for routine dental care, most vision exams for eyeglasses, hearing aids, cosmetic surgery, and long-term custodial care. Being aware of these exclusions helps Greensboro residents plan for potential out-of-pocket expenses.

What are the three requirements for Medicare?

To qualify for Medicare, you generally need to be a U.S. citizen or a lawful permanent resident for at least five years, be 65 or older (or have a qualifying disability), and have a work history that includes paying Medicare taxes. The specialists can confirm these requirements for you.

How much will Medicare cost me each month?

Your monthly Medicare costs depend on which parts of Medicare you choose and your income level. Part B has a standard premium, but it can be higher for individuals with higher incomes. Prescription drug plans also vary in cost. Get a free quote for your personalized monthly expenses.
